Juventus Star Paul Pogba Receives Four-Year Ban for Doping Violation

Juventus midfielder Paul Pogba has been dealt a devastating blow to his career after receiving a four-year ban from all footballing activities due to a positive test for a banned substance. The Frenchman’s doping violation was confirmed on Thursday, February 23, marking a significant setback for the talented player.

Pogba, a product of the Manchester United Academy, had shown immense promise throughout his career but has struggled with injuries in recent seasons, limiting his playing time. With this ban, his hopes of fulfilling his potential and representing his country on the international stage have been severely dashed.
